LGBTQ+ Issues therapists in Saint Albert, AB Statistics

LGBTQ+ Issues therapists in Saint Albert, AB average 11 years of experience and charge around $173 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(66%), Person-Centered Therapy (Rogerian) (66%), and Narrative Therapy (63%).
